Young's Strengths and Weaknesses

Young possesses several qualities that made him the top pick in the draft:

  • Exceptional accuracy: He consistently places the ball where his receivers can make plays.
  • Pocket presence: Young is adept at navigating the pocket, avoiding pressure, and extending plays.
  • Football IQ: He demonstrates a high understanding of the game, making smart decisions under duress.

However, Young also faces some challenges:

  • Size: At 5'10", he is smaller than most NFL quarterbacks, which can affect his vision and ability to see over the offensive line.
  • Durability: His smaller frame raises concerns about his ability to withstand the physical demands of the NFL.

The Browns' Defensive Game Plan

The Browns' defensive coordinator, Jim Schwartz, is known for his aggressive and attacking style. Expect him to dial up the pressure on Young, forcing him to make quick reads and decisions. The Browns will likely employ a variety of blitzes and stunts to disrupt the Panthers' offensive line and get after Young. Key defensive players to watch include:

  • Myles Garrett: The Browns' star defensive end is a disruptive force who can single-handedly wreck an offensive game plan.
  • Za'Darius Smith: Another dominant pass rusher who will be looking to exploit any weaknesses in the Panthers' offensive line.
  • Denzel Ward: A shutdown cornerback who will be tasked with covering the Panthers' top wide receiver.

The Browns defense is going to test Young's ability to read defenses and make the right throws under pressure. This is where his experience and preparation will truly be tested.

Key Matchups to Watch

Several key matchups will likely determine the outcome of this game:

  • Myles Garrett vs. Ikem Ekwonu: This battle between the Browns' star pass rusher and the Panthers' young left tackle will be crucial. Ekwonu needs to protect Young's blind side and prevent Garrett from disrupting the Panthers' offense.
  • Denzel Ward vs. Adam Thielen: Ward will likely be tasked with covering the Panthers' top wide receiver, Thielen. Thielen's ability to get open and make plays will be critical to the Panthers' passing game.
  • Nick Chubb vs. Panthers' Front Seven: The Panthers' defensive front needs to contain Chubb and limit his effectiveness. If Chubb can run wild, it will be a long day for the Panthers' defense.
  • Bryce Young vs. Browns' Defensive Coordinator Jim Schwartz: This strategic battle will be fascinating to watch. Schwartz's ability to devise schemes to confuse and pressure Young will be a major factor in the game's outcome. Young's ability to read those schemes and make the right decisions will determine his success.
